The man who plays a hero in Christopher Nolan's Batman movies has become a real-life hero when he bravely defused a fight between two homeless men.

According to the almost always reliable National Enquirer Christian Bale was witnessed Christmas shopping near his home in Brentwood, Los Angeles. From there the tale gets much more interesting as two vagrants began to have a loud shouting match near the actor and his family. The source informs the tabloid, "I could not believe what I was seeing. It wasn't clear what the people were arguing about - but it soon became apparent that their conversation was heading toward a violent incident."

"One of the homeless guys cocked back his fist and was just about to strike the other man - but out of nowhere Christian Bale appeared and got in the middle of them! Christian acted like a referee and told the homeless men to take it elsewhere - and away from all the families that were enjoying the peaceful surroundings."


The Dark Knight Rises hits theaters July 20th 2012 and stars Christian Bale as Bruce Wayne/Batman, Michael Caine as Alfred Pennyworth, Garly Oldman as Jim Gordon, Tom Hardy as Bane, Anne Hathaway as Selina Kyle, Joseph Gordon-Levitt as John Blake and Marion Cotillard as Miranda Tate.
